⭐ How the Safefood Turkey Calculator Works
This calculator follows the official Safefood Ireland cooking time rules:
Unstuffed Turkey
40 minutes per kilogram + 20 minutes
Stuffed Turkey
45 minutes per kilogram + 20 minutes
The calculator takes your turkey’s weight (kg), applies the correct formula, and converts the total into easy-to-understand hours and minutes.
Example
A 5 kg unstuffed turkey →
(5 × 40) + 20 = 220 minutes → 3 hours 40 minutes
This ensures your turkey reaches a safe cooking temperature, reducing the risk of foodborne illness and undercooking.

⭐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. What temperature should I cook my turkey at?
Safefood generally recommends 180°C (350°F) for a conventional oven, but always follow your oven manufacturer’s instructions.
2. How do I know my turkey is safely cooked?
Use a meat thermometer:
-
Insert into the thickest part of the thigh
-
Temperature should read at least 75°C
If you don’t have a thermometer, check that:
-
The juices run clear
-
There is no pink meat inside
3. Does stuffing increase the cooking time?
Yes — a stuffed turkey requires more time because the heat must reach the centre of the stuffing.
The calculator automatically includes this.

5. What size turkey do I need for my family?
A general Safefood guideline:
-
4–6 people → 4–5 kg
-
6–8 people → 5–6 kg
-
8–10 people → 6–7 kg
-
10–12 people → 7–8 kg
